- # This migration demonstrates importing from SOAP/WSDL.
- id: weather_soap
- label: SOAP service providing weather.
- migration_group: wine
- source:
- # We use the SOAP parser source plugin.
- plugin: url
- data_fetcher_plugin: http # Ignored - SoapClient does the fetching.
- data_parser_plugin: soap
- # URL of a WSDL endpoint.
- urls: http://www.webservicex.net/globalweather.asmx?WSDL
- # The function to call on the service, and the parameters to pass. See
- # http://www.webservicex.net/New/Home/ServiceDetail/56 for the XML structure
- # of this feed - how CountryName is passed within the GetCitiesByCountry
- # XML element.
- function: GetCitiesByCountry
- parameters:
- CountryName: Spain
- # Responses may be returned as an XML string, an object, or an array - specify
- # the type of response here.
- response_type: xml
- # Looking at the XML response at http://www.webservicex.net/globalweather.asmx/GetCitiesByCountry,
- # we see that the data items we want are within <NewDataSet><Table>.
- item_selector: /NewDataSet/Table
- # For each field, 'name' is the source property name to be used in the process
- # steps below, 'label' is optional (to document the property), and selector
- # is an xpath (-like, for array and object returns) string relative to the
- # item_selector for retrieving that data value.
- fields:
- -
- name: Country
- label: Country
- selector: Country
- -
- name: City
- label: City
- selector: City
- # 'ids' tells us what source property ('City') holds the unique identifying
- # value for each imported item, and what schema type to use to hold that
- # value in the migration map an message tables.
- ids:
- City:
- type: string
- process:
- vid:
- plugin: default_value
- default_value: migrate_example_wine_varieties
- name: City
- destination:
- plugin: entity:taxonomy_term
